3D Designers are responsible for the creation of concepts that challenge the standard event/environmental design. Able to articulate ideas in the most appropriate form through sketches/Vectorworks/C4D or images/visuals, excelling in translating a creative proposition into a three-dimensional environment. This position will support our EMEA Creative team. It is eligible to work a hybrid schedule, generally requiring work in-office one day a week (typically Wednesdays) at our London location.
Responsibilities:
- Takes client briefs and interprets client content and brand messaging.
- Design engaging environments working alongside other creatives, client directors and external contractors.
- Apply a good knowledge of new technologies to effectively create unforgettable experiences.
- Possess an awareness of cost and design to a budget.
- Create high-quality 3D visuals using industry standard software, ideally Cinema 4D in combination with the Adobe Creative Suite.
- Attend pitch presentations and sell in a design.
- Produce in depth technical drawings to help guide the stand production process.
- Liaison with manufacturing contractors to monitor quality and finish.
- Attend on site to ensure handover to the client before the show.
